摘要

A bioelectrochemical fuel cell using bacteria as catalyst was investigated inthis paper. The bacteria were obtained from the bottom sediment of Baltic Sea, and then cultivated in a 1 liter bioreactor. Raw material for fermentation were glucose first and then fish meat or plankton biomass. After certain fermentation time, broth was used as fuel for the fuel cell. A steady power output (200 microW/ml anodic volume) was obtained by using stainless steel net packing with graphite particles as the anode electrode. Different fermentation conditions were tested for maximum electroactive substance output. The experimental study of the fuel cell were carried out in the following manners: (1) characteristics of the fuel cell; (2) mediator effect on the current output; (3) mode of the fuel flow.
